#seneca giving you the cold shoulder?
Some students have reported problems getting onto IRC and specifically into #seneca. The reason for this is that we have changed the channel’s mode such that only registered users (i.e., nicks) can join. This was done to stop an endless barrage of spambots from joining and leaving the channel.
